Output d815075ca4bf3ce558ba85ceaab20b83ebb1387fcc541e74f75cfaa0c64ffaea:21

value
18840000
script pubkey
OP_0 OP_PUSHBYTES_32 f091e9f99210b9e59fd596af4e1c9c81882dd68d0996167f5d5cc55a707b9886
address
bc1q7zg7n7vjzzu7t874j6h5u8yusxyzm45dpxtpvl6atnz45urmnzrqqnapat
transaction
d815075ca4bf3ce558ba85ceaab20b83ebb1387fcc541e74f75cfaa0c64ffaea
confirmations
139163
spent
true